Transaction

955094604d1b2f46777c19031878ef01cc20faff19fcdcbde6470de8cd7cf8f8
443,478 confirmations
Timestamp
1510593034
Block494,224
Fee322,320 sats
Fee rate510 sats/vB
view on mempool.space

Inputs & Outputs